Jazz Tangcay Artisans EditorNetflix has unveiled the first look at Paolo Sorrentino’s “The Hand of God.”The film, which will have its world premiere at the 78th Venice International Film Festival on Sept.
2, tells the story of Fabietto Schisa, an awkward Italian teen whose life and vibrant, eccentric family are suddenly upended — namely by the electrifying arrival of soccer legend Diego Maradona, who inadvertently saves Fabietto, setting his future in motion.The story is a deeply personal one to “The Great Beauty” director Sorrentino.
Speaking with Variety in 2015, he revealed, “Aside from all the things I’ve said before about Maradona, he involuntarily saved my life.
